In 2007 I worked in California from January to May. Then I moved back to Minnesota for the summer, and worked there from June to October. I have a driver's license in Minnesota... does this make me a Minnesota resident? Then in October I moved back to California for the second time, and finished 2007 working in California again. What federal form do I need to fill out when I have worked in both California and Minnesota? What state form do I need for Minnesota, and what form do I need for the state of California?

You are a part-year resident of both states and must file as such.

The California Form is Form 540NR; not sure about Minnesota.
